What's the heaviest a dog can weigh?

The greatest weight ever recorded for a dog, 343 pounds (155.6 kg), was that of an English Mastiff from England named Aicama Zorba of La Susa, although claims of larger dogs, including Saint Bernards, Tibetan Mastiffs, and Caucasian ovcharkas exist.

What dog weighs 220 pounds?

St. Bernard

Bernards weigh between 63 and 100 kilograms (140 and 220 pounds) on average, and stand anywhere from 70 to 90 centimetres (27 to 35 inches) tall. A St. Bernard named Benedictine holds the world record for the Heaviest Dog Ever.

What dog weighs 190 pounds?

Mastiff. In terms of weight, Mastiffs tend to be the heaviest among the giant breeds, with both males and females averaging between 175 and 190 pounds. The breed has been admired for its strength and bravery since the Roman Empire, where it was used as a war and guard dog.

What's the heaviest a dog can be?

English Mastiffs: The English Mastiff is the largest dog breed. They are officially the world's biggest (height/weight) dog breed. According to Guinness World Records, the longest and heaviest dog in the world was Aicama Zorba, who weighed 343 pounds (156 kilograms) and stood 37 inches (94 centimeters) at the shoulder.

What is the 7 7 7 rule for dogs?

The "7 7 7 rule" for dogs is a puppy socialization guideline, originally by Pat Hastings, suggesting exposing puppies to 7 different people, 7 different locations, and 7 different surfaces/objects/sounds/challenges (variations exist) by about 7 weeks old to build confidence, resilience, and prevent fear or anxiety as adults. Key experiences include meeting diverse individuals, visiting different places like a vet's office or friend's house, walking on various substrates (grass, tile, carpet), and encountering new objects and gentle challenges (like tunnels or boxes).

What breeds make up an XL?

In the creation of the XL Bully, the other breeds crossed with the Pitbull are always large heavily muscled dogs like the American Bulldog, Olde English Bulldogge, Cane Corso and the American Staffordshire Bull Terrier. plus some large mastiff-type breeds.
